Please
review these instructions before submitting your request for a new WX listing.
There are many airports that have
AWOS facilities without being connected to NOAA.
Therefore, your request may not be fulfilled for a particular
airport for that reason.
Before proceeding, please check the existing listings to see if your station is already there. There have been a few requests in the past for stations that are already on the list.
You can check to see if the airport ID you're looking for is available for weather reporting by doing the following:
1. Click on any of the existing airport identifiers in the list above. After the page has loaded in, look at the URL address in your browser's address window near the top.
An example for Culpeper would be: http://weather.noaa.gov/weather/current/KCJR.html2. Change the last three letters of KCJR in the URL address line to the airport identifier you're looking for, making sure that the replacements are in UPPER CASE as in KRDU. Now the new address should appear like this: http://weather.noaa.gov/weather/current/KRDU.html
3. With the cursor at the end of the URL address, press enter and now the browser will attempt to locate that page. If the URL address disappears, try pressing ctrl-z to bring it back and then get rid of any highlighting of the URL address. This is not normally a problem.
4.If the airport identifier is not available from the NOAA system, you'll see an error message of the type: "URL not found" or something to that affect. Otherwise, the weather information will be displayed.
